This is a custom order of Honey Soap that's now curing.  I love my logo stamp, but I tend to try it too soon after cutting.  These were cut about four days ago, and I stamped them yesterday.  I should have stopped at one or two...sigh.  I'm pretty sure my customer will be ok with it, though.   On a technical note, this batch was put in the fridge after pouring.  I wanted to prevent gel, due to the honey I was afraid it would get too hot and crack or creep up in the mold.  I kept it refrigerated for 24 hours, but as you can see, it looks like it still gelled partial

Lots of experiments

Today I got the chance to indulge in soaping for most of the day.  I did four batches today, using a technique I've never tried before, courtesy of a great   Youtube tutorial from SophiasNaturals .  She demonstrates an interesting form of thermal transfer that I haven't seen, immediately mixing the lye water into the hard oils until melted.  The liquid oils are added after.  I used this method for all my soaping today and it seemed to work well.  I didn't need to use the stick blender very much at all, which helped me tremendously as I often tend to overmix.  I wanted to attempt the "Holly Swirl", which is basically an in the pot swirl done twice.  Sorta..  I had a lot of half bottles of fragrances, so I did some custom scent blending, too. It was a day of experimenting. Top:  Small batch trying  Sweet Cakes "Aria" .  I used a some ruby mica for a cute little swirl.  It smells so good right now.
